Table 1: Functions of Automotive Wheel Bearings

Function Importance
Support vehicle weight Prevent wheel collapse
Enable smooth wheel rotation Reduce friction and improve handling
Manage radial and axial forces Ensure stability and prevent wheel wobble

Table 2: Types of Automotive Wheel Bearings

Type Features Applications
Ball Bearings Simple and cost-effective Lightweight vehicles
Roller Bearings Higher load capacity Heavy-duty vehicles
Tapered Roller Bearings Durability and extended lifespan High-performance vehicles

Effective Strategies, Tips, and Tricks

  • Regular Maintenance: Inspect and lubricate bearings定期检查和润滑轴承 periodically to prevent premature wear.
  • Proper Fitment: Ensure bearings are correctly installed and torqued as per manufacturer specifications.
  • Avoid Contaminants: Prevent dirt, water, and other contaminants from entering bearings, as they can cause damage.
  • OEM Replacements: Use genuine OEM replacement bearings to ensure compatibility and long-term performance.

Common Mistakes to Avoid

  • Overtightening: Avoid excessive force when tightening bearings, as it can damage the race and bearing components.
  • Improper Lubrication: Use only specified lubricants and apply them according to manufacturer recommendations.
  • Ignoring Warning Signs: Be aware of bearing failure symptoms, such as grinding noises, vibration, or wheel wobble, and address them promptly.
